More about Highlands Community Services

Our services span multiple areas, all interwoven to provide wrap-around services and the most comprehensive care possible.

HCS Adult Recovery Services provide a community support system for people in recovery who have a serious mental illness and have difficulty functioning independently in the community. We are able to provide support with the goals of preventing hospitalization, focusing on strengths and abilities, accessing needed resources, and maintaining natural support systems through meaningful relationships.

HCS Intellectual Disability Services provide a detailed Person-Centered Plan to individuals with significant limitations both in intellectual functioning and in adaptive behavior, originating before the age of 18. Our agency believes that within every disability is ability, and that a good life is possible for all individuals we serve.

HCS Outpatient Services are designed to provide an array of services for children, adolescents, and adults whose substance abuse or emotional challenges have caused significant impairment in social, vocational, educational and/or family functioning but who do not require hospitalization. We focus on specific issues that are crucial to achieving or maintaining a healthy lifestyle.

HCS Emergency Services provide attentive, emergent care to consumers and families who present as needing immediate assistance. Emergency Services include triage, information and referral, appointment scheduling, discharge planning, and crisis intervention. More often than not, Emergency Services staff can be found at our local hospital providing services within the emergency room setting.

HCS Psychiatric Clinic Services implement appropriate medication services for qualifying HCS consumers. Psychiatric Services are provided by the staff, medical director, psychiatric nurse practitioners, licensed practical nurses, and contract psychiatrists working together as a team.

HCS Children's Services serve families, children, and adolescents in multiple settings including local schools, homes, in the community, and at HCS clinical office locations. Areas include school-based services, intensive family services, care coordination, autism services, crisis stabilization, early intervention, prevention, and many more that are specifically designed to meet the needs of at-risk children and their families.
